Meaning of SATISFY in English

[verb] [T] - to please (someone) by giving them what they want or needWhy are some people never satisfied?I offered him $10 000 to keep quiet, but that didn't satisfy him and he wanted even more.Many countries cannot satisfy the needs of (= provide what is necessary for) their people.She satisfied the court (= The court believed) that she was innocent. [+ object + that clause](formal) The authorities were satisfied of/satisfied as to (= they accepted) the seriousness of his situation.Come on, satisfy my curiosity (= tell me what I want to know), tell me when your wedding is!If you satisfy the requirements for something, you are considered suitable enough for it or you have the qualifications necessary for it.She satisfied the entrance requirements for the college and was accepted as a student.There are three main conditions you must satisfy if you wish to be a member of this club.(UK formal) To satisfy the examiners means to pass an examination.
